Freshpaint is a powerful analytics platform that allows businesses to track and analyze user behavior on their websites and applications. With its seamless integration to Salesforce, businesses can now take their data analysis to the next level. By connecting Freshpaint to Salesforce, businesses can gain valuable insights into their customers' interactions, preferences, and purchasing patterns. This integration enables businesses to make data-driven decisions, personalize customer experiences, and optimize their sales and marketing strategies. With Freshpaint's integration to Salesforce, businesses can unlock the full potential of their data and drive growth like never before.
This integration guide will walk you through the process of integrating Freshpaint with Salesforce. By integrating these two platforms, you can seamlessly transfer data between Freshpaint and Salesforce, allowing you to streamline your customer relationship management processes and improve overall efficiency.
Before you begin the integration process, make sure you have the following prerequisites in place:
1. Access to a Freshpaint account with administrative privileges.
2. Access to a Salesforce account with administrative privileges.
3. Basic understanding of Freshpaint and Salesforce functionalities.
1. Log in to your Freshpaint account.
2. Navigate to the settings section and select "Event Tracking."
3. Identify the events you want to track and set up event properties.
4. Make sure to include any custom properties that you want to transfer to Salesforce.
1. Log in to your Salesforce account.
2. Navigate to the App Manager and click on "New Connected App."
3. Fill in the required details such as the connected app name, API name, and contact email.
4. Enable OAuth settings and specify the callback URL.
5. Configure the required OAuth scopes and save the changes.
1. In the Salesforce Connected App settings, click on "Manage" next to "Connected App OAuth Usage."
2. Click on "New" to create a new OAuth usage.
3. Specify the username and select the appropriate profile.
4. Save the changes and note down the generated Consumer Key and Consumer Secret.
1. Log in to your Freshpaint account.
2. Navigate to the settings section and select "Integrations."
3. Search for the Salesforce integration and click on "Connect."
4. Enter the Consumer Key and Consumer Secret generated in Step 3.
5. Authenticate your Salesforce account by following the provided instructions.
6. Map the Freshpaint event properties to the corresponding Salesforce fields.
7. Save the integration settings.
1. Trigger the events in Freshpaint that you want to transfer to Salesforce.
2. Verify if the data is successfully transferred to Salesforce.
3. Check if the data is correctly mapped to the corresponding Salesforce fields.
1. Regularly monitor the data transfer between Freshpaint and Salesforce.
2. If you encounter any issues, refer to the integration logs and error messages.
3. Troubleshoot the problem based on the specific error message or contact Freshpaint and Salesforce support for assistance.
Congratulations! You have successfully integrated Freshpaint with Salesforce. Now you can leverage the power of both platforms to enhance your customer relationship management processes. Make sure to regularly monitor the integration and troubleshoot any issues that may arise to ensure a seamless data transfer between Freshpaint and Salesforce.